HomeSort by relevance Sort by last modified time
    Searched refs:MemoryPool (Results 1 - 6 of 6) sorted by null

  /external/webkit/Source/ThirdParty/ANGLE/src/compiler/preprocessor/
memory.h 48 typedef struct MemoryPool_rec MemoryPool;
50 extern MemoryPool *mem_CreatePool(size_t chunksize, unsigned int align);
51 extern void mem_FreePool(MemoryPool *);
52 extern void *mem_Alloc(MemoryPool *p, size_t size);
53 extern void *mem_Realloc(MemoryPool *p, void *old, size_t oldsize, size_t newsize);
54 extern int mem_AddCleanup(MemoryPool *p, void (*fn)(void *), void *arg);
memory.c 81 MemoryPool *mem_CreatePool(size_t chunksize, unsigned int align)
83 MemoryPool *pool;
88 if (chunksize < sizeof(MemoryPool)) return 0;
100 void mem_FreePool(MemoryPool *pool)
114 void *mem_Alloc(MemoryPool *pool, size_t size)
143 int mem_AddCleanup(MemoryPool *pool, void (*fn)(void *), void *arg) {
symbols.h 71 MemoryPool *pool; // pool used for allocation in this scope
100 Scope *NewScopeInPool(MemoryPool *);
tokens.h 75 TokenStream *NewTokenStream(const char *name, MemoryPool *pool);
tokens.c 68 static char *idstr(const char *fstr, MemoryPool *pool)
94 static TokenBlock *lNewBlock(TokenStream *fTok, MemoryPool *pool)
163 TokenStream *NewTokenStream(const char *name, MemoryPool *pool)
symbols.c 77 Scope *NewScopeInPool(MemoryPool *pool)

Completed in 398 milliseconds